Try using a nettie pot. It will rinse out your sinuses. Google it, it's a little pot you use to rinse your sinuses with a special saltwater solution. It will get rid of the allergens. You can do this once or twice a day. It has really helped my husband's allergies. You can get one at your drug store for $15, and it's dishwasher safe.

You don't, though there are things you can do to lessen the symptoms.

Find out what you're allergic to and get it out of your environment. Take out your carpets and wash your curtains regularly in a hypo-allergenic soap. Dust frequently with a damp cloth. Make sure the filters to your furnace and AC are clean.

And see an allergist, since OTC medicines aren't doing it for you.
